Click on the gear icon in the upper right, then Settings in the dropdown. There is a Clock Display Time in the Advanced Settings. Switch it to 24 hour, then tap/click on Submit. This is an Account setting. Any new devices that you add in the future will be on the 24 hour clock.

Launch the Fitbit app on your paired device and tap Today . Tap your profile picture and select App Settings . Select Time Zone . Turn off Set Automatically . Tap Time Zone and choose the time zone you'd like your Fitbit to recognize. If you'll be in a different time zone only for a short ...

Many clock faces and certain apps have an always-on display mode. To turn always-on display on or off, swipe right from the clock face to open quick settings. Tap the always-on display icon . Turning on this feature impacts your watch 's battery life. RiekoC · Disable Automatic Time Zone and Automatic location · Change the time zone to something else · Do a manual sync on the Fitbit app &middo...In the Fitbit App, click profile photo, App Settings. Turn off automatic time zone and location and set the time zone manually, then resync, it should set the time correctly. Sometimes it may be necessary to restart the watch for …

You can reset your Fitbit Surge Time Zone on your mobile device, by opening the Fitbit App > Account > Advance Settings >Time Zone. If the Time Zone is set on "Automatic" the next synchronization should help your Surge to take the same date from your phone.
